The scope of the meeting is to discuss the ongoing start of the LSST survey in the context of strongly lensed transients, primarily supernovae.

 

Sample of topics we could include. Please, add your favorites and then we can think of groupings and formats  that make sense.

  • Status of Survey and alert stream, references, depths, image quality, …

  • The landscape of known galaxy lenses, cluster lenses, lensed AGNs (e.g., from EUCLID)

  • Lessons learned from gLSNe to date

  • Simulations and expected rates of transients: SNIa, CCSN, SLSN, TDEs, KN, …

  • Follow-up resources lined up for imaging and spectroscopy, including space and AO

  • Scene modeling photometric pipelines for lensed SN/QSO photometry from multiple telescopes for time delays

  • Fitting tools for photometric time delays

  • Spectroscopic time delays, when does it work, how does it compare with photometry

  • Lens modeling tools

  • Microlensing 

  • Blind analysis process

  • Optimization of use of resources: telescopes and humans  

  • Publication strategy/policy

  • Lens vetting / transient vetting

  • Integrating different search approaches: catalog cross-matching, direct-search including image time series, light curve, magnitude-color based methods

Registrants are encouraged to suggest additional topics for discussion.
